Understanding Common Conservatory Issues
Conservatories are mainly made of glass and metal, which are susceptible to various forms of wear and tear. Some of the most common issues that require emergent repairs consist of:

Leaks and Water Ingress
Water permeating through the roof or walls typically results from deteriorating seals or damaged glass. This problem can lead to mold development and structural damage.
Broken or Cracked Glass Panels
Broken glass can result from extreme climate condition or impacts. Not only do they compromise insulation, but they also provide safety hazards.
Weakening Framework
Metal frameworks, such as aluminum or steel, can rust or rust with time, affecting the structural integrity of the conservatory.
Temperature Regulation Issues
Poor insulation can lead to considerable temperature level changes, making the space uneasy and ineffective for usage throughout the year.
Structure Issues

Actions for Emergent Repairs
When challenged with emergent conservatory repairs, following a structured technique can guarantee that the issues are dealt with efficiently and efficiently. Here are the essential actions to take:

Assessment and Inspection
Begin by performing an extensive inspection of the conservatory. Identify and document noticeable damages, and examine for any concealed issues that may not be right away obvious.
Prioritize Repairs
Determine which issues are most urgent, such as threats like broken glass, and which require more extended attention, such as interior leaks.
Contact Professionals
For considerable repairs, engaging certified contractors or conservatory experts is a good idea. Their know-how makes sure that repairs fulfill security standards and bring back the structure's integrity.
Temporary Solutions
For issues that need instant attention, such as broken glass, consider applying momentary fixes. For instance, covering split panels with plastic sheeting can avoid water ingress and keep some insulation.
Permanent Repairs
When short-term measures are in location, schedule long-term repairs. This might include changing glass panels, resealing joints, or strengthening structural components.
Post-Repair Maintenance
